I am a partner in a major law firm that probably does lobbying out of our D.C. office, though I don't know on behalf of whom.
It's the same thing as accusing Obama of "taking money from oil companies" because individual employees of energy companies have donated to him. I personally represent energy companies -- hell, every lawyer in Houston represents an energy company somewhere along the way. However, my political inclinations and actions are not driven or dictated by those clients.
My donations to Barack Obama are strictly on my own behalf and out of my own conscience and commitment. I refuse to be disqualified from following that conscience and commitment simply because someone in my firm might be a lobbyist or because we represent clients who have lobbyists.
None of my partners are involved and I certainly don't discuss my donations with them. I suspect this is true of the very, very great majority of Obama contributors.
